Показать сообщение отдельно
Старый 09.10.2008, 16:51   #3  
Gustav is offline
Gustav
Moderator
Аватар для Gustav
SAP
Лучший по профессии 2009
 
1,858 / 1152 (42) ++++++++
Регистрация: 24.01.2006
Адрес: Санкт-Петербург
Записей в блоге: 19
Цитата:
Сообщение от breakpoint Посмотреть сообщение
у меня нет в link 3го параметра...
ax 3 sp3
У меня тоже. Поэтому: "ТОВАРИСЧ! ДЕЛАЙ ЧЕРЕЗ RANGE!"
Цитата:
Сообщение от Gustav Посмотреть сообщение
В какой-нибудь Range второго датасорса написать: (RecID==ПервыйДС.RecID)

Как здесь: Связи и Query
Как-то так:
X++:
qbr = qbdCustTransCredit.addRange(fieldnum(CustTrans, RecId))
qbr.value('(RecId==CustTransDebit.RecId)');

// и чтобы юзера вдруг не разрушили, но видели
qbr.status(RangeStatus::Locked);
Где CustTransDebit - имя первого датасорса.